Checking of protection disengaging timeThis time delay is activated on the falling edge of each fault signal. It processesvery brief transient faults which, when repetitive, allow T to be reached.The relay linked with the protection must not be a latching relay in order for thischeck to be performed.c parameter settingv set Tdis to the desired valuec testv set up the chronometer wiring so that it will start up when injection stops <strong>and</strong> thedropping out of the protective relay will stop the counting operationv create a fault by injecting current <strong>and</strong> voltagev reset the chronometer to zerov stop current or voltage injection <strong>and</strong> start up the chronometerv when the <strong>Sepam</strong> relay drops out, read the Tdis value on the chronometerChecking of the protection activation zone (sector)c parameter settingv set T to 0.05 sv select the sectorc testv inject voltage which corresponds to Vo > Vso (see section on N Vol Disp)v preset current Io to twice Iso, with a phase shift of 90° <strong>and</strong> then 270° with respectto Vov vary the phase shift angle a of the injection unit so as to determine the anglelimits of the activation zonesector normal zone inverse zone83° 97°…180°…263° 277°…0°…83°86° 94°…180°…266° 274°…0°…86°v reset to zero when leaving the zone each time the output relay is activated.<strong>Sepam</strong> 2000 - Testing1/17
